| Taxonomy Code | 106H00000X |
| Display Name | Marriage & Family Therapist |
| Taxonomy Group | Behavioral Health & Social Service Providers |
| Taxonomy Classification | Marriage & Family Therapist |
| Definition | A marriage and family therapist is a person with a master's degree in marriage and family therapy, or a master's or doctoral degree in a related mental health field with substantially equivalent coursework in marriage and family therapy, who receives supervised clinical experience, or a person who meets the state requirements to practice as a marriage and family therapist. A marriage and family therapist treats mental and emotional disorders within the context of marriage and family systems. A marriage and family therapist provides mental health and counseling services to individuals, couples, families, and groups. |
| Effective Date | September 30, 2009 |
